Q: Is 379,042 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 379,042 is a composite number.

Why is 379,042 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 379,042 can be evenly divided by 1 2 79 158 2,399 4,798 189,521 and 379,042, with no remainder.

Since 379,042 cannot be divided by just 1 and 379,042, it is a composite number.
